
Line Types for Templates
The layout of a template is static, which means that you determine it before the Smart Form is executed. To do this, you can define line types in the
Table Painter, whose sequences and appearances are the same as in the output. Describing a template with line types could look like this:
The output of this template consists of five lines, for which only three different line types are used:
By specifying an interval you can use one line type for several subsequent lines of the template. By specifying a reference you can reuse any existing line type at any position of the template. You can make changes only to the 'master' line type.
Unlike with
line types for tables, for templates you specify a fixed line height for the line type. Any output that does not fit into a cell is truncated.
